In Hindu Dharma, rangoli is drawn during every festival, auspicious occasion, religious rituals, etc. All these are associated with some Deity Principle. During these days, the Divine Principle of a specific Deity is present in the atmosphere in a greater proportion. To attract maximum of the Deity’s Principle, rangolis that attract and transmit its Principle are drawn so that everyone gets spiritual benefits.
